VisualC++与Oracle数据库编程实战指南

4星 · 超过85%的资源 需积分: 5 10 下载量 168 浏览量 更新于2024-10-28 收藏 3.97MB PDF 举报
"VisualC++与Oracle数据库编程案例,适合入门级别的学习者,详细讲解了如何使用VisualC++和Oracle数据库进行系统开发。" 在计算机编程领域,VisualC++是一种功能强大的开发工具,尤其适用于创建桌面应用程序。它以其丰富的类库和对Windows API的深入支持而闻名。本教程聚焦于使用VisualC++与Oracle数据库进行集成开发,是针对初学者的指南,特别强调实践案例。 Oracle数据库是全球广泛使用的大型关系型数据库管理系统,提供高效的数据存储和处理能力。在VisualC++中与Oracle数据库进行交互,可以采用多种技术,包括MFC(Microsoft Foundation Classes)中的ODBC(Open Database Connectivity)、ADO(ActiveX Data Objects)以及Oracle专为C++开发者提供的OO4O(Oracle Objects for OLE)接口。 本书的第一部分主要讲解Oracle数据库基础和VisualC++中数据库编程的各种方法。ODBC是访问数据库的标准接口,允许VisualC++通过ODBC驱动程序连接到Oracle数据库。ADO则是微软提供的更高层次的数据库访问技术,简化了数据库操作,提供了更简单的API。而OO4O是Oracle提供的原生接口,使得C++开发者可以直接操作Oracle对象,提供了更高效且低级别的访问控制。 第二部分则通过一系列管理系统开发案例,逐步展示如何进行系统设计、数据库设计和实现,以及系统的具体实现过程。这些案例涵盖了管理信息系统的常见应用场景,帮助读者理解如何将理论知识应用到实际项目中,提升数据库编程技能。 书中的案例详细而全面,包含了系统需求分析、数据库表结构设计、SQL查询编写、用户界面构建、错误处理等多方面内容,旨在使读者不仅能够学习到编程技术,还能掌握项目开发的整体流程和最佳实践。 本书适合已经具备一定VisualC++基础知识和初步数据库知识的读者,是学习数据库驱动应用程序开发的理想教材。同时,对于相关专业的大学生进行项目设计,也是一份宝贵的参考资料。书中融入了作者多年项目开发的经验和技巧,有助于读者从更专业的角度掌握VisualC++与Oracle数据库的整合开发。 这本书通过实例教学,旨在帮助读者熟练掌握VisualC++与Oracle数据库的结合,提升开发管理信息系统的综合能力。通过学习,读者不仅能学会编程技术,还能了解项目管理与实施的关键步骤,为今后的软件开发工作打下坚实基础。